| Mensagem: | Hi Renata, I've been living in the Tampa Bay area for 5 years now. Florida has a special ESOL (English for Speakers of Other Languages) program for children enrolled in public schools. I've seen many monolingual Brazilian children starting at school with no English at all and just after a few months they're speaking English fluently. You shouldn't worry they'll do just fine, I guarantee you. After awhile your main concern will be that they don’t want speak Portuguese. Anyway, in the Miami area there is a bilingual English/Portuguese public school sponsored by the Brazilian Consulate.
